The 529 Plan: Mechanics and Strategic Advantages
The primary appeal of the 529 lies in its tax-deferred growth and the ability to withdraw funds tax-free for qualified education expenses. As we look toward the 2026 fiscal environment, staying informed on evolving 529 plan policy is essential for maximizing contribution limits. One powerful tactic involves front-loading these accounts to capture years of additional market participation. The super-funding rule allows contributors to treat a single large contribution as if it were spread over five years for gift tax purposes. This accelerated funding jumpstarts the compounding process while efficiently reducing the size of a taxable estate. Additionally, provisions under the SECURE Act 2.0 now allow for the potential rollover of unused funds into a Roth IRA, significantly mitigating the risk of overfunding.
Alternative Vehicles for Education Capital
When control and flexibility are paramount, alternative structures like UTMA or UGMA accounts offer distinct advantages. These custodial accounts allow for a broader range of investment types, including individual stocks or private equity, though the assets eventually transfer to the beneficiary at the age of majority. This transfer of ownership is a critical consideration; while it provides the child with a significant head start, it also counts more heavily against financial aid eligibility than assets held in a 529 plan. For families who value maximum liquidity, a taxable brokerage account provides a secondary layer of protection. It doesn’t offer the same tax breaks, but it lacks the usage restrictions found in dedicated education accounts, allowing for a pivot if a child’s educational path changes.
Strategic planners often weigh the following variables when selecting a vehicle:
- Ownership and Control: 529 plans allow the owner to change beneficiaries, whereas UTMAs belong strictly to the child once they reach adulthood.
- Tax Treatment: Different accounts offer varying levels of tax-deferred growth or tax-free distributions for specific costs.
- Financial Aid Impact: Assets held in a parent’s name generally have a lower impact on aid calculations than those owned by the student.
Some strategists also look to Roth IRAs as a dual-purpose reserve. These accounts provide a safety net for retirement while allowing for penalty-free withdrawals of contributions for education costs. Tax-Efficient Distributions and Timing
The landscape of education funding was fundamentally altered by the SECURE Act 2.0. This legislation introduced the ability to roll over up to $35,000 of unused 529 assets into a Roth IRA for the beneficiary, provided the account has been open for at least 15 years. This provision eliminates the common fear of overfunding and provides a seamless transition from education savings to the start of a child’s retirement security. It reflects a shift toward more flexible, human-led wealth management. Navigating the strict definition of qualified expenses is essential to avoid the 10% penalty on non-qualified withdrawals. Are 529 plans still worth it if my child receives a scholarship?
Scholarships don’t render these accounts obsolete. You can withdraw funds equal to the scholarship amount without the 10% penalty, though the earnings portion will be subject to income tax. Alternatively, the assets can remain in the account to fund graduate school or be rolled over into a Roth IRA under current legislative provisions. How does a 529 plan affect my child’s eligibility for financial aid?
Assets held in a 529 plan are typically treated as parental assets on the FAFSA, which has a much smaller impact on aid eligibility than assets owned directly by the student. Specifically, parental assets are assessed at a maximum rate of 5.64%, while student assets are assessed at 20%. Can I use 529 plan funds for private K-12 tuition?
You can use up to $10,000 annually per beneficiary for tuition at private, public, or religious K-12 schools. What happens to the money in a 529 plan if the child does not go to college?
If a beneficiary chooses a different path, you retain several high-level options for the capital. You can change the beneficiary to a qualifying family member or use the funds for registered apprenticeship programs and trade schools. The SECURE Act 2.0 also permits rolling over up to $35,000 into a Roth IRA for the original beneficiary. Can I transfer a college savings plan to another family member?
Transferring assets to another family member is a straightforward process that supports a multi-generational legacy. You can change the beneficiary to siblings, first cousins, or even yourself without triggering federal income tax or penalties. How do 529 plans integrate with my estate planning strategy?
These plans serve as a sophisticated tool for estate compression by allowing you to remove assets from your taxable estate while maintaining ownership. Contributions are considered completed gifts, yet you retain the power to change beneficiaries or control the timing of distributions.
